This road cycling route takes you through the charming villages of Elslack, Airton, and Skipton, providing picturesque scenery and a glimpse into the local history. With a total distance of 64km and an ascent of 1102m, this loop is well-suited for intermediate cyclists. The route offers a mix of rolling hills and flat stretches, making it accessible for avid amateurs. With highlights such as Elslack's rural landscapes, Airton's traditional stone buildings, and Skipton's medieval castle, this route provides a delightful mix of countryside and cultural attractions. Overall, this route offers a great balance between challenge and reward, showcasing the beauty of West Yorkshire's countryside while passing through charming towns and landmarks.

Silsden, situated in West Yorkshire, United Kingdom, offers a range of cycling opportunities for both road and gravel cyclists. Silsden features picturesque countryside and well-maintained roads suitable for road cyclists. Gravel cyclists can explore the adjacent countryside on various tracks and trails. Nearby, there are notable cycling spots like the Yorkshire Dales, offering stunning landscapes and challenging climbs.
